Tufts Launches Food Innovation Hub to support cellular agriculture, bioprocessing and scale-up

August 18, 2026

Tufts University has launched a new Innovation Hub for Food and Materials in Massachusetts, creating shared infrastructure for cellular agriculture, bioprocessing, food formulation and scale-up as developers work to move emerging technologies from research toward commercial products.

Tufts has launched an Innovation Hub for Food and Materials, with a fully equipped 17,000ft2 facility scheduled to open in fall 2026.
The Hub will provide cell culture, bioprocessing, formulation and scale-up capabilities alongside test kitchens, sensory analysis and a large cell bank.
Tufts has invested US$4.6 million in shared research infrastructure, while a US$2.1 million MassTech grant has supported the food and materials technology core.

Located in Medford, the Innovation Hub has been designed for startups, established companies, entrepreneurs, academic researchers and nonprofit organizations developing new food technologies, biomaterials, novel ingredients and processing systems.

Interim space is available immediately, while the fully outfitted 17,000ft2 facility is scheduled to begin operations this fall.

The Hub brings together infrastructure spanning early research, prototyping, characterization, processing, culinary development and early-stage consumer testing. Its food and materials technology core will include capabilities in cell culture, bioprocessing, food and material formulation and scale-up production.

“The Innovation Hub for Food and Materials reflects Tufts’ long-standing commitment to advancing technology in food, health, and materials science,” said Bernard Arulanandam, Vice Provost for research at Tufts University. “Tufts’ capabilities in nutrition, biomedical sciences, and engineering create a collaborative environment where Hub participants have one resource to tap into a broad range of expertise.”

The facility will work closely with the Tufts University Center for Cellular Agriculture, which conducts interdisciplinary research into producing meat, alternative proteins, novel materials and other animal-derived products from cells rather than whole animals.

Its work also extends to plant-derived biomaterials and hybrid plant-animal cell systems.

Among the Hub's resources will be an extensive cell bank containing animal and insect cells as well as a plant cell repository covering more than 2,000 species.

For food developers, the facility will include a fully equipped test kitchen and sensory analysis suite, allowing products to be evaluated under conditions closer to those encountered by consumers. Chef and consumer testing can be incorporated throughout the product development process.

Tufts has also included a “technology sandbox” aimed at companies developing equipment used during R&D and production.

Bioreactor manufacturers, extrusion technology developers and suppliers of materials characterization equipment will be able to test and improve their systems within an integrated development environment rather than evaluating individual components in isolation.

“We’ve consistently heard from both researchers and industry that there is a need for shared infrastructure to move ideas forward,” said David Kaplan, Stern Family Endowed Professor of Engineering.

“The Innovation Hub for Food and Materials is designed to meet the needs of academics looking to commercialize a new innovation, small companies that may not have the resources to test manufacturing capabilities, larger companies focused on production that would like to explore new products or technologies, or anyone that might be missing even a small part of the process to bring a product from idea to market,” he added.

The Hub will also house a BioLabs-operated incubator at 200 Boston Avenue in Medford, providing 46 laboratory benches alongside dedicated desks, private offices, meeting rooms and shared working facilities for early-stage life science and biotechnology companies.

Its food and materials technology core has been supported in part by a US$2.1 million grant from the Massachusetts Technology Collaborative.

Tufts itself has committed US$4.6 million to expanding shared research infrastructure and product development capabilities. The university reported that the investment, combined with Massachusetts state and philanthropic support, was intended to help translate research into new products, businesses and jobs.

The facility will extend beyond food into biomaterials for applications including medicine, textiles and agriculture, with expertise available in material design, characterization and application.

It will also be integrated with the Tufts Food & Nutrition Innovation Institute at the Friedman School of Nutrition Science and Policy. The institute connects food industry and nonprofit organizations with university researchers working in areas including bioactive compounds, sustainable food systems and novel ingredients.

For cellular agriculture companies in particular, the combination of specialist cell resources, bioprocessing equipment and product development facilities provides access to capabilities that can be expensive for early-stage businesses to build independently.

The Hub will be open to qualified commercial, academic and nonprofit partners.
